Duck Pinz
Duck pin bowling offers a fantastic twist on the classic game, making it much more accessible for younger children who might struggle with heavy standard bowling balls. Duck Pinz brings this retro, fast-paced game right to the area with a vibrant, family-friendly atmosphere. The smaller pins and balls mean everyone from toddlers to grandparents can compete on an even playing field. Between frames, families can enjoy snacks and craft drinks from the lounge. Plan your visit accordingly: they are open Sunday through Monday until 8 PM, Tuesday through Thursday until 10 PM, and Friday through Saturday until 11 PM.
Topgolf Jacksonville
Take a short drive into Jacksonville to experience a driving range unlike any other. Topgolf transforms traditional golf into a high-tech, interactive video game that anyone can play, regardless of their skill level. Your family will get a private, climate-controlled hitting bay where you take turns launching microchipped golf balls at giant dartboard-like targets on the outfield. The massive venue also features great food, music, and an energetic atmosphere that keeps teenagers and adults thoroughly entertained. You do not have to cut your evening short here, as the venue stays open until 1 AM.
Yulee Bowling & Amusements
For a traditional bowling experience packed with extra entertainment, Yulee Bowling & Amusements serves as a staple for local and visiting families. Besides well-maintained lanes and automatic scoring systems, the facility features a lively arcade where kids can win tickets for prizes. The snack bar serves up classic alley favorites like pizza and fries, making it easy to combine dinner and an activity into one stop. It is a fantastic place to burn off some late-night energy. The fun continues until 10 PM on weekdays and extends all the way to 1 AM on weekends.
K1 Speed Jacksonville
If your family has a need for speed, K1 Speed provides an adrenaline-pumping evening. This premier indoor go-kart racing facility uses fully electric karts that are fast, safe, and environmentally friendly, eliminating the strong exhaust smells found at outdoor tracks. The challenging road-course style track will test the driving skills of older kids and adults alike. Before you race, you will receive a thorough safety briefing, ensuring everyone feels comfortable behind the wheel. The track stays hot until 10 PM on weekdays and midnight on weekends.

Fantastic Fudge
No family evening is complete without a sweet treat. Fantastic Fudge sits in the heart of historic downtown Fernandina Beach, drawing visitors with the rich scent of chocolate and sugar. Watch through the window as they make fudge the old-fashioned way on massive marble slabs. Alongside their namesake fudge, they serve generous scoops of premium ice cream and hand-dipped chocolates. It is the perfect place to grab a cone before a nighttime stroll down Centre Street. They satisfy sweet tooths until 9 PM on weekdays and 10 PM on weekends.

Down Under
Hidden away under the bridge, Down Under Restaurant provides a unique dining experience right on the Intracoastal Waterway. This iconic local spot gives families the chance to watch boats pass by and spot local wildlife while enjoying authentic Southern seafood. The rustic, nautical decor perfectly matches the fresh catches, oysters, and famous shrimp dishes coming out of the kitchen. The kitchen serves up these waterfront meals until 9 PM on weekdays and 9:30 PM on weekends.

Amelia River Cruises & Charters
Experience the waters around the island from a completely different perspective by booking a sunset cruise. Amelia River Cruises & Charters offers family-friendly evening boat tours that navigate the salt marshes, wilderness beaches, and historic riverfronts. The knowledgeable captains share fascinating stories about local history and point out wildlife like dolphins, manatees, and wild horses on Cumberland Island as the sky turns brilliant shades of pink and orange.

Alhambra Theatre
For a slightly longer drive into Jacksonville, the Alhambra Theatre offers one of the longest-running professional dinner theaters in the country. This provides a brilliant two-for-one evening of fine dining followed immediately by a high-quality stage production. The menu often themes itself around the current show, making the entire night a cohesive, memorable theatrical experience that older kids and teenagers will appreciate.
